How much do remote machine learning neuroscience jobs pay per year?

As of Aug 22, 2026, the average yearly pay for remote machine learning neuroscience in the United States is $42,584.00, according to ZipRecruiter salary data. Most workers in this role earn between $32,500.00 and $46,000.00 per year, depending on experience, location, and employer.

Join a pioneering AI initiative focused on building the next generation of evaluation benchmarks for frontier AI models. We are seeking experienced Machine Learning Engineers and Researchers to bring hands-on expertise in model development, experimentation, and evaluation to create rigorous benchmark tasks for advanced AI systems.
In this role, you will design sophisticated, multi-step machine learning challenges inspired by real-world research workflows. From implementing experimental ideas and running training pipelines to analyzing model behavior and validating results, you will help establish high-quality evaluation benchmarks that reveal the strengths and limitations of frontier AI models.
This is a fully remote, full-time engagement requiring approximately 35 hours per week.
Requirements
Key Responsibilities
  • Design realistic machine learning benchmark tasks based on research workflows, including model implementation, experimentation, training, evaluation, and performance analysis.
  • Translate open-ended research concepts into structured, reproducible evaluation tasks with clearly defined success criteria.
  • Implement machine learning solutions using Python, execute experiments, and produce reference implementations that demonstrate correct methodology and expected outcomes.
  • Develop benchmark tasks involving reinforcement learning concepts such as reward functions, policy optimization, training dynamics, and model behavior where applicable.
  • Evaluate AI-generated solutions by identifying implementation errors, experimental flaws, incorrect reasoning, and unsupported conclusions.
  • Collaborate with AI researchers and fellow subject matter experts to continuously improve benchmark quality, technical rigor, and evaluation consistency.
